Output 512bcc628bdf3d49d6426a81e820e75e219875983b78a52dbbfd866fdc8ce69c:1

value
3952323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88573c844535a211530a6792e632eb7f9fa32ed6 OP_EQUAL
address
3E7vKvX6tXnutZagzAgASfj6mszY6jEzSp
transaction
512bcc628bdf3d49d6426a81e820e75e219875983b78a52dbbfd866fdc8ce69c
confirmations
539373
spent
true